Method

Brewed Coffee (per 4 cups)

1

Measure and grind beans

Measure 0.5 cups (about 60–65 g) of fresh whole coffee beans. Grind to a medium grind appropriate for drip brewing — similar to granulated sugar. A consistent grind ensures even extraction.

2

Preheat equipment and rinse filter

Pour 0.5 cups of filtered hot water into the empty coffee carafe and run it through the filter into the sink (or pour over the filter if using a manual brewer) to warm the carafe and remove any paper taste. Discard the rinse water and place the rinsed filter in the brew basket.

3

Add grounds

Place the freshly ground coffee into the prepared filter, leveling the bed with a gentle shake or tap so the grounds are even.

4

Heat brewing water

Bring 4 cups (about 960 ml) of filtered water to 195–205°F (90–96°C). If you don't have a thermometer, heat to just off a rolling boil, then wait 30 seconds.

5

Brew

Start the brewing cycle (if using an automatic drip machine) or, for manual pour-over, begin by pouring about 80–100 ml of hot water in a circular motion to saturate the grounds (bloom) and wait 30–45 seconds. Continue pouring in steady concentric circles, keeping the water level consistent until you have poured the full 4 cups. Total contact time for pour-over should be about 3.5–4 minutes; auto-drip will complete on its own.

6

Serve

Once brewing completes, remove the filter and discard wet grounds. Swirl the carafe gently to homogenize the brew. Pour into cups and offer milk, sugar, or flavored syrup on the side.

7

Storage/holding

Serve brewed coffee immediately for best flavor. If holding, use a preheated thermal carafe and consume within 30–45 minutes to avoid bitter, over-extracted taste from prolonged warming.

Optional Additions (per cup)

8

Offer milk, cream, sugar or syrup alongside the brewed coffee. Add 2 tbs milk or cream, 1 tsp sugar, or 1 tsp syrup per cup, or to taste. Stir and taste-adjust before serving.
